United States ADP Employment Change
May 6, 2026 - Nela Richardson Chief Economist, ADP. Job gains occured in education and health services (57K), trade, transportation, and utilities (36K), professional and business services (11K), leisure and hospitality (8K), construction (8K), financial activities (7K) and manufacturing (3K). In contrast, the natural resources and mining sector shed 3K jobs and information lost 9K. Meanwhile, companies with fewer than 50 employees added 67K new hires, those with 500 or more added 40K and medium-sized firms contributed 17K.

United States ADP Nonfarm Employment Change
May 7, 2026 - The ADP National Employment Report is a measure of the monthly change in non-farm, private employment, based on the payroll data of approximately 400,000 U.S. business clients. The release, two days ahead of government data, is a good predictor of the government's non-farm payroll report.

ADP Employment Report: What is it and its importance | StoneX EN
2 weeks ago - It is also an earlier release to its US government-produced change in nonfarm payrolls (NFPs) The methodology for calculating the ADP National Employment Report is managed by Moody's Analytics. ... Labor market indicator: The report gives us a timely look at private sector employment, a big part of the US economy. By tracking private sector employment, the ADP report helps measure job gains and job losses, pay growth and sectoral employment trends. Predictive value: The ADP report is released two days before the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) releases its more comprehensive Employment Situation Report which includes data on both private and government employees.

ADP National Employment Report Preliminary Estimate for February 7, 2026
February 24, 2026 - The NER Pulse is an estimate of the week-over-week change in employment based on a four-week moving average. These estimates are based on ADP's finely tuned, high-frequency data. The data is seasonally adjusted and have a two-week lag to allow for more complete and accurate estimates of real-time employment trends. The NER Pulse, including 12 weeks of historical data, publishes every Tuesday at 8:15 a.m. ET, except weeks when ADP Research publishes the monthly National Employment Report which is built on a reference week that includes the 12th day of the month.
